Sustainability has been moving up on the business agenda in recent decades, and many methods to assess corporate sustainability have already been created. One of the most used and reliable methods is the Sustainability Reporting Guidelines of the Global Reporting Initiative (GRI). Given the importance of sustainability for society and organizations, this study examined sustainability reports published by mining companies – Alcoa, Vale and Samarco – since 2006. The objective was to verify the indicators that contribute most to the minimization of environmental impacts and the improvement of environmental performance. The methodology consisted of collecting and analyzing data from the GRI sustainability reports. It was discovered that the sustainability reports helped the companies to identify improvement opportunities and it is essential companies provide in their reports an economic, environmental and social context of their activities. Furthermore, it was found out that the indicators related to atmospheric emissions, solid waste generation, environmental protection expenditure, and the consumption of raw materials, energy and water are the ones more attached to the production process, which means they are the main contributors for the environmental performance improvement

A dynamic systems water resources simulation model was developed as a tool to help to analyze water resources management alternatives for the Piracicaba, Capivari and Jundiaí River Water Basins (BH-PCJ). Different politics policy were simulated for 40-year. The model estimates water supply and demand, as well as contamination load from several consumers. Six runs were performed using average precipitation value, changing water supply and demand, and different volumes diverted from BH-PCJ to BH-Alto Tietê For the Business as Usual, the Sustainability Index went from 0.41 in 2010 to 0.22 by 2050; the Water Use Index changed from 80.7% in 2010, to 125.5% by 2050; and the Falkenmark Index changed from 1,302 m 3 person -1 year -1 in 2010 to 774 m 3 P -1 year -1 by 2050. It was noticed that sanitation is one of the biggest concerns in the near future at PCJ River Basin.

The leather footwear industry is an important sector in the Brazilian economy. The tannery industry accounted for $ 2.05 billion to exports in 2011, which represents a contribution of 6.86% to the Brazilian balance of trade. However, it is a highly polluting industry generating highly toxic and hazardous waste. Therefore, it is extremely important to search for environmental management actions that allow a cleaner production and waste recycling to prevent its discharge into the environment resulting in the deterioration of nature and quality of human life. Thus, based on a literature review and exploratory research, this study consisted of an analysis of some environmental management actions adopted by the leather industry in Franca - SP verifying if the industries have certifications or follow standards that characterize a responsible environmental management. This study is justified by the fact that tanneries and footwear industries produce highly hazardous waste, and therefore environmental actions are necessary to treat the waste effectively in order to minimize its environmental impacts. The literature review and empirical research conducted demonstrated the development of new techniques and technologies aiming at mitigating the impacts of leather waste in the environment. These actions are crucial for companies to remain competitive and focused on sustainability in this rapidly growing market.

The increase of the world population and their consumption power requires companies to increase their production capacity to meet demand. This production process is often performed without control and degrades the environment. In view of the stiffness of the legal requirements and the increasing of environmental concerns, companies need to act in a sustainable way to continue existing. The main objective of this study is to investigate how sustainability reports that follow the guidelines of the Global Reporting Initiative (GRI) can bring benefits to companies in the continuous improvement of its processes and the competitiveness of the sector. The sector chosen for the study was the automotive industry, due to its importance in the national economy and the significant impacts caused to the population and to the environment. The methodology consists of reading the GRI sustainability reports of companies and then performing a comparison among them and the bibliography of the subject. The results confirm the importance of the GRI sustainability reporting for companies and show how the selected indicators can contribute to the corporate management and to the control of its processes

O monitoramento da qualidade do solo pelos atributos físicos é importante para a avaliação e manutenção da sustentabilidade dos sistemas agrícolas. Um atributo indicador da qualidade do solo deve ser sensível às variações do manejo ao qual está sendo submetido. Este estudo teve como objetivo avaliar o parâmetro S como indicador da qualidade física do solo e a agregação de um Latossolo Vermelho distrófico, submetido a sistemas de manejo sem ou com a inclusão de plantas de cobertura em pré-safra durante 11 anos. Os tratamentos foram: sistema convencional (SC) e sistemas conservacionistas compostos por plantas de cobertura, crotalária (SDC), milheto (SDM) e lablabe (SDL). O delineamento experimental foi o de blocos casualizados, com quatro tratamentos e seis repetições; as camadas constituíram-se nas parcelas subdivididas. Os sistemas conservacionistas SDC, SDM e SDL apresentaram maior teor de matéria orgânica em relação ao SC nas camadas de 0 a 0,05 m. Maiores valores de diâmetro médio ponderado e geométrico dos agregados foram observados nos sistemas conservacionistas. O solo apresentou boa qualidade física determinada pelo índice S, com valores todos superiores a 0,035.
